This provocation emerged from a reflective dialogue between Nisha Poulose and Leon Seefeld about the publication of the book “Bioregional Financing Facilities – Reimagining Finance to Regenerate Our Planet” of which Leon is a co-author. The book makes a case for establishing a new layer of the global financial architecture that becomes the connective tissue between financial resources and on-the-ground regenerators. While the book takes a needed look at what is required to ‘add’, this provocation provides a view that is alternative in some ways and complementary in others, by placing the focus on what might be important to ‘remove’.
